moroccan restaurant
A full-service restaurant specializing in foods prepared in the culinary traditions of Morocco.
A Moroccan restaurant is a full-service eatery specializing in foods prepared in the culinary traditions of Morocco.
Moroccan cooking identifies the specialty rather than the establishment's address or decor. The restaurant can operate outside Morocco.
The full-service arrangement distinguishes it from Middle Eastern fast food, whose stated regional scope also includes Moroccan cuisine.
